#include "itkImageFileReader.h"
#include "itkImageFileWriter.h"
#include "itkCommand.h"
#include "itkSimpleFilterWatcher.h"
#include "itkMaximumProjectionImageFilter.h"
#include "itkExtractImageFilter.h"
int itkMaximumProjectionImageFilterTest2(int argc, char * argv[])
{
if( argc < 4 )
{
std::cerr << "Missing parameters " << std::endl;
std::cerr << "Usage: " << argv[0];
std::cerr << "Dimension Inputimage Outputimage " << std::endl;
return EXIT_FAILURE;
}
int dim = atoi(argv[1]);
typedef unsigned char PixelType;
typedef itk::Image< PixelType, 3 > ImageType;
typedef itk::ImageFileReader< ImageType > ReaderType;
ReaderType::Pointer reader = ReaderType::New();
reader->SetFileName( argv[2] );
typedef itk::MaximumProjectionImageFilter< ImageType, ImageType > FilterType;
FilterType::Pointer filter = FilterType::New();
filter->SetInput( reader->GetOutput() );
filter->SetProjectionDimension( dim );
// to be sure that the result is ok with several threads, even on a single
// proc computer
filter->SetNumberOfThreads( 2 );
itk::SimpleFilterWatcher watcher(filter, "filter");
typedef itk::ImageFileWriter< ImageType > WriterType;
WriterType::Pointer writer = WriterType::New();
writer->SetInput( filter->GetOutput() );
writer->SetFileName( argv[3] );
try
{
writer->Update();
}
catch ( itk::ExceptionObject & excp )
{
std::cerr << excp << std::endl;
return EXIT_FAILURE;
}
return EXIT_SUCCESS;
}
